    Increasing liquidity is naturally good. Help me understand the table please: when the (up to) 1m KLIMA is minted, we'll go from ca 4mn to 5mn issued. The USDC/BCT pool disbanding goes into treasury apart from 100k BCT and ca 1.7mn USDC. The USDC goes into the KLIMA/USDC pool. What happens with the 100k BCT? How do we prevent the 25% (based on 1mn) dilution in issued KLIMA?
    Thanks

      Sirob Yeah, so the 100k BCT technically goes back in the treasury, but can't be counted towards our reserves or runway as it has already been paired with the pKLIMA. So we'll go from 4mn to 4.1mn circulating KLIMA after this liquidity exercise, and the rest of the mints will be measured out over future weeks.

      We plan on balancing dilution primarily by reducing future KLIMA/USDC bond capacity. The 1mn pKLIMA will be redeemed over the span of many months, so we can allay future mints to counteract this inflation we pull forward and put to use today.

        optima This is a trade off decision. I don't have a particularly strong opinion, but would be interested to understand the pros and cons of:

        1. Current proposal: dilute everyone by the newly minted KLIMA, but keep the USDC from the LP for costs etc
          and
        2. Use the freed up USDC to buy BCT or MOSS and pair in the treasury to limit the dilution

        Thanks for your thoughts.

          Sirob Definitely swimming in a sea of trade-offs.

          With pKLIMA minting & USDC used for LP, mainly
          Pros:

          • Capital efficient - treasury obtains KLIMA at 1BCT ea.
          • KLIMA not staked, no APY loss for stakers
          • Key liquidity rail bolstered

          Cons:

          • Reduction of KLIMA premium in BCT (dilution)

          Great point with USDC as potential dilution moderation. USDC can definitely be used to moderate the dilution from pKLIMA mints, if we were to purchase BCT or MOSS OTC.

          We will have the $1,467,902 after this liquidity exercise - so BCT/MOSS OTC buys are certainly on the table and would be great for reserves. It's mainly a question of timing and opportunity cost imo. USDC buying BCT or moss would be good for reserves, runway, and other QOL metrics - but we can also perform these acts any time. So main cons are losing the stockpile of liquid capital, and the opportunity cost of potentially using that USDC for liquidity or exchange listings.

              FluctusLux Yeah, 100% agree we have excess capital in BCT/USDC and that the pool doesn't align with our long-term vision of KLIMA as currency.

              Disbanding any of our liquidity pools, our public infrastructure, is delicate... BCT/USDC is an exception to the rule, imo.
              It's a pretty stark case in favor of disbanding BCT/USDC today, but I certainly wouldn't want to set a precedent that we're comfortable chopping up our public infrastructure so decisively.

              Any KLIMA/CARBON pair is going to be diamond handed by Policy for eternity, so those pools won't be disbanded in the future. So yeah, I agree there's a great pool of capital to redirect in BCT/USDC - but we want to be measured when making any major shifts in our liquidity composition.

              IBuyShitCoins @FluctusLux
              I think maintaining a rather modest pool of BCT/USDC is important for Klima Infinity partners who are looking to meet their short-term offsetting goals by buying and offsetting BCT directly using USDC. If we remove this pool entirely, they will be forced to go with USDC>KLIMA>BCT with higher fees instead.
